Bangalore road yet to get 26/11 martyr Sandeep's name
- Tuesday November 29, 2011
- Karnataka News | Express News Service
It has been three years since Major Sandeep Unnikrishnan lost his life fighting terrorists in Mumbai. However, the promises made by the Bruhat Bangalore Mahangara Palike (BBMP) to name a road and install his statue remain unfulfilled, still.
